Low turnover rates and tenured teams are living proof: 2025 Great Places to Work Certified Employee stock ownership program eligibility begins on day one of employment (ESOP contribution is targeted at 6% of your annual compensation) Company paid parental leave Generous time off package Multiple benefit plans , eligibility begins on day one of employment Culturally focused on work/life balance, and the overall wellness of our employees Position Summary DMA is looking for enthusiastic, driven individuals to join our Indirect Tax - Development Program -a specialized entry-level opportunity designed to build your knowledge, sharpen your skills, and prepare you for long-term success. In this 12-18-month structured program, you'll be introduced to DMA's Compliance Operations in either Transaction Tax or Property Tax , determined during the interview process. You'll gain hands-on experience, receive targeted training, and be fully immersed in our company culture. Our goal is to help you discover where your strengths lie and support your growth with mentorship, professional development, cross-functional exposure, and a clear path toward a rewarding career within DMA. Throughout the program, you'll gain insight into the diverse career paths and advancement opportunities available at DMA-including, but not limited to, roles in Compliance, Consulting, Real Estate, Implementation, Business Development/Sales, and our Management Trainee/Leadership track. Essential Duties and Responsibilities - Transaction Tax Compliance Collect, analyze, and process data for the timely completion and filing of transaction tax returns Process tax returns and filings for assigned clients in DMA's proprietary software Prepare check batches and electronic payment batches Monitor, review, and resolve jurisdictional tax notices Complete month end reporting (scanning, uploading, Year to Date tracking, etc.) Prepare bank reconciliations for applicable clients Familiarizes with state and local tax compliance changes Maintain a professional relationship with clients Assist with projects such as amended returns, address change, name change, closures, etc. Essential Duties and Responsibilities - Property Tax Compliance Perform property tax data analysis, reconciliation, and import into PTMS, OneSource, PowerPlan, and DMA's internal software PTCA Update and maintain client tax information and database Submit completed returns to Supervisor/Manager for review by assigned due date Monitor and review all jurisdictional tax notices for assigned clients by assigned due date Prepare tax payments on behalf of clients for jurisdictional liabilities by assigned due date Review the missing bills and notices reports and research items not received Prepare funding requests to send to the client to receive funds for timely payments Ensure all applicable returns/renditions/tax bills and remittances are processed and mailed in a timely manner Respond to client and jurisdictional inquiries Non-essential Duties and Responsibilities Attend routine meetings with Professional Development Training Team and complete self-development projects and tasks as assigned Work closely with other divisions to better understand company initiatives Assist analysts and supervisors as needed Perform other duties as assigned Education and Qualifications Current college student that will obtain a Bachelor's or Master's in Accounting, Business Administration, Finance, Mathematics, Economics, Data Analytics or other related field Previous internship experience in a related field/industry strongly preferred Adaptability to changing situations and fast-paced environment Demonstrate sense of ownership and self-motivation Thrives in a team environment and works to achieve shared goals Advanced critical thinking and problem-solving skills Possess leadership initiative Ability to work well under pressure Strong attention to detail Intermediate skills in Microsoft Office products Excellent verbal and written communication skills #LI-HH1 #LI-ONSITE The Company is an equal employment opportunity employer and is committed to providing equal employment opportunities to its applicants and employees.
